Joao Pedro's Impact on Chelsea: A New Era for the Blues' Attack

Joao Pedro has made an explosive entry into Chelsea's attacking lineup, showcasing his talent in the recent Club World Cup. With two stunning goals against Fluminense, the Brazilian forward not only stamped his authority on his first full start but also turned heads in the football world. This article explores his journey, performance, and what it means for Chelsea's future, particularly in their ongoing quest for a reliable centre-forward.

The Rise of Joao Pedro

Joao Pedro, a name that has been making waves ever since his move from Brighton to Chelsea, is quickly becoming a fan favorite. Known for his versatility and technical skills, the Brazilian has the potential to transform Chelsea's attacking game. The Blues have invested heavily in their forward options, spending over £600 million since the American ownership took over in 2022. With 19 forwards signed during this period, the competition for a starting spot has never been fiercer.

Early Career: From Watford to Brighton

Before his transfer to Chelsea, Joao Pedro honed his skills at Brighton & Hove Albion, where he scored 30 goals in 70 appearances. His journey began at Watford, where he showcased his potential, attracting attention from top clubs with his performances. His ability to play in multiple attacking roles makes him an asset to any team.

His Debut Performance: A Statement Made

Joao Pedro's performance against Fluminense was a masterclass in attacking football. Starting the match, he quickly made his presence felt by scoring two goals that not only demonstrated his scoring ability but also his understanding of the game.

First Goal: A Stunning Effort

The first goal came after just 18 minutes. Pedro collected a half-cleared cross just outside the penalty area. After steadying himself with a touch, he unleashed a powerful shot that flew past the veteran goalkeeper Fabio and into the far corner. This goal not only opened the scoring but set the tone for the match.

Second Goal: A Perfect Finish

His second goal was equally impressive. After receiving a through ball from Enzo Fernandez, Pedro darted into the box and struck a right-footed shot that hit the crossbar before finding the net. This goal further solidified his status as a player to watch and raised eyebrows regarding his potential impact at Chelsea.

Statistical Highlights

Pedro's performance was not just about the goals; it was also about his overall influence on the game. Here are some key statistics from his match against Fluminense:

  • Goals: 2
  • Shots on Target: 2
  • Total Shots: 3
  • Touches: 26
  • Duels Won: 9
  • Aerial Duels: 4

These numbers indicate that he was not merely a goal scorer but also actively involved in various aspects of play, including linking up with teammates and contributing defensively.

Comparative Analysis: Pedro vs. Other Forwards

When comparing Joao Pedro's performance to that of his fellow forwards at Chelsea, a few patterns emerge:

  • Christopher Nkunku: While he also registered a significant number of shots, Pedro's efficiency in front of goal was highlighted by his two goals from three attempts.
  • Nicolas Jackson: Although Jackson contributed to the team, his touches were more centralized, whereas Pedro's versatility allowed him to impact both flanks.
  • Liam Delap: Delap's performance showcased a more static style, contrasting with Pedro's dynamic movement and ability to drift wide.

These differences indicate that Joao Pedro may offer unique qualities that could benefit Chelsea's attacking strategy moving forward.
